Our knowledge of the topography of Late Roman Dertosa is very limited, with a serious ignorance of the very
limits of urban core. Archaeological research is slowly filling the vacuum left by the epigraphy and the ancient
texts. Excavations led in the El Rastre ravine have confirmed the existence of a necropolis area that extends in
the space that had been occupied by a suburbial area until 200 AD. Some remains of Late Roman houses are
also documented in a marginal place of the north slope of the Suda hill.
